Study on the correlation between postoperative mental flexibility, negative emotions, and quality of life in patients with thyroid cancer

In recent years, the global incidence of thyroid cancer has increased year by year. The purpose of this study is to investigate the post-surgical psychological flexibility and negative feelings of patients with thyroid cancer and their association with quality of life.
